#ef3e03 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ef3e03 is composed of 93.7% red, 24.3%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 15 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 47.5%. #ef3e03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7c06 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#ef3e03

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070200 is the darkest color, while #fff5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ef3e03

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7673 is the less saturated color, while #ef3e03 is the most saturated one.
